# New Hope for Brain Bleeding: How Hydrogen Therapy Fits Into Revolutionary Stroke Treatments Brain bleeding strokes are one of the deadliest types of strokes. But scientists are finding new ways to help patients survive and recover better than ever before. ## What the Researchers Did Scientists looked at 60 years of research on brain bleeding strokes. These strokes happen when blood vessels burst inside the brain. The medical name is [Intracerebral Hemorrhage](/explore-by-condition/intracerebral-hemorrhage). The researchers studied how treatments have changed since the 1960s. They looked at drugs, exercise programs, and newer therapies. This includes hydrogen therapy and other treatments that protect brain cells. This [original research study](/study/decoding-spontaneous-intracerebral-hemorrhage-mechanistic-breakthroughs-and-disruptive-revolution-in-pharmacological-treatment-1780253725007) reviewed hundreds of other studies. The scientists wanted to find the best ways to help stroke patients. ## What They Found About Hydrogen and Brain Protection ### Multiple Treatments Work Better Than One The biggest finding was simple: using several treatments together works much better than using just one. Doctors get the best results when they combine different approaches for each patient. ### Hydrogen Therapy Shows Promise for Brain Bleeding The researchers found that hydrogen therapy helps protect brain cells in several ways: - **Reduces harmful molecules**: Hydrogen removes dangerous molecules called free radicals. These molecules damage brain cells after a stroke. - **Fights inflammation**: Brain bleeding causes swelling. Hydrogen helps reduce this harmful swelling. - **Protects brain cells**: Hydrogen helps brain cells survive when they don't get enough oxygen. ### Exercise and Rehabilitation Are Key The study showed that exercise programs help patients recover faster. Physical therapy and rehabilitation can help rebuild brain connections. This is especially important for [Hemorrhagic Stroke](/explore-by-condition/hemorrhagic-stroke) patients. ### Early Treatment Saves Lives The researchers found that quick treatment saves more lives. The first few hours after a brain bleed are critical. Fast action can prevent more brain damage. ## Why This Matters for Stroke Recovery ### Better Survival Rates Brain bleeding strokes used to kill most patients. Now, with better treatments, more people survive. The death rate has dropped significantly over the past 20 years. ### Improved Quality of Life Patients who get multiple treatments often recover better. They can walk, talk, and think more clearly than patients who only get basic care. ### Hope for [Hypertensive Brain Hemorrhage](/explore-by-condition/hypertensive-brain-hemorrhage) Patients High blood pressure causes many brain bleeds. The research shows that even these serious cases can be treated successfully with the right combination of therapies. ## The Bigger Picture: How Hydrogen Fits Into Modern Stroke Care This review adds to growing evidence about hydrogen therapy for brain injuries. The [hydrogen general research](/blog/category/general) shows hydrogen can help in many ways: **Neuroprotection**: Hydrogen protects nerve cells from damage. This is crucial when brain cells are dying from lack of oxygen. **Anti-inflammatory effects**: Brain swelling makes strokes worse. Hydrogen reduces this harmful inflammation. **Oxidative stress reduction**: Free radicals attack damaged brain tissue. Hydrogen neutralizes these harmful molecules. The researchers noted that hydrogen therapy works well with other treatments. It doesn't replace emergency surgery or blood pressure medicines. Instead, it adds another layer of protection for brain cells. ### Multimodal Therapy is the Future The study emphasizes that the future of stroke treatment is "multimodal." This means using many different treatments at once. Each treatment targets a different part of the problem. For example, a patient might receive: - Emergency surgery to stop bleeding - Medicines to control blood pressure - Hydrogen therapy to protect brain cells - Physical therapy to rebuild strength - Speech therapy to restore communication ## What This Means for Patients and Families ### Treatment is More Hopeful Now Brain bleeding strokes are still serious.
